Pricing Analysis
Price comparison per million tokens
For input processing, Claude Opus 4.6 ($5.00/1M tokens) is 10.0x more expensive than DeepSeek-R1-0528 ($0.50/1M tokens).
For output processing, Claude Opus 4.6 ($25.00/1M tokens) is 11.6x more expensive than DeepSeek-R1-0528 ($2.15/1M tokens).
In conclusion, Claude Opus 4.6 is more expensive than DeepSeek-R1-0528.*
* Using a 3:1 ratio of input to output tokens
Context Window
Maximum input and output token capacity
Claude Opus 4.6 accepts 1,000,000 input tokens compared to DeepSeek-R1-0528's 131,072 tokens. DeepSeek-R1-0528 can generate longer responses up to 131,072 tokens, while Claude Opus 4.6 is limited to 128,000 tokens.

License
Usage and distribution terms
Claude Opus 4.6 is licensed under a proprietary license, while DeepSeek-R1-0528 uses MIT.
License differences may affect how you can use these models in commercial or open-source projects.
